    Nope, just report them to the Credit Services Association - you could read the debt collectors Code of Practice that the CSA has recently imposed and find the examples where DRP have breached it, so your complaint holds more weight.

    Someone has just reported that they got the Financial Ombudsman involved and which seems to have paid dividends.
